    I struggle with puffy roots and I feel like the roots (apart from your ends) are one of the most neglected parts when styling. People usually put the product on their strands, but forget their roots and your roots have the worst tangles lol. After I style, my hair then frizzes, but in general, I make sure to twist tight at the root and to wear a scarf which flattens the puffiness. I've even heard even some ppl have suggested doing a twaidout at the root to minimize puffiness
